Edited by: Ayanami Nova on 17/09/2005 14:57:03 Im looking for a friendly and exciting group of people who like to stomp on other peoples heads.
I played this game when it first came out but got bored after about 9 months due to lack of content and quit, i have been back now for about 3 weeks with a new character and have around 750k skill points (all combat related, no mining, industry etc). At the moment i am traiining towards inty skills so my role in the corp would most likely be as either a tackling frigate or a support cruiser until i am better trained. I am trained up in sensor dampening and tracking disrupting which compliments my role as support.
Ok, thats the main gist of it - here's the bit which is giving me a headache. I am female which has caused various problems with previous corp/gang members. Firstly everyone wants me to actually prove that i am female....im not sure why this actually matters but it is normally sorted if the corp uses teamspeak. Second i get things ranging from people asking for advice on women thought to people asking for cybersex. This is not gonna happen, im here to play a game. Finally people start to act like *******s and come up with crap like "i dont trust women" or the latest classic " i play this game to get away from my girlfriend so i dont want to deal with women while i play". As you can see the treatment i am getting is going from idiotic to borderline sex discrimination.
I have teamspeak but prefer not to use it as i feel it ruins the roleplay element of the game. I can appreciate the need to use it in large battles so this is pretty much the only time i will use it.
I am based in the UK and usually play 3-5 nights a week.
If there is a corp that can meet my requirements and come to terms with the social dreadnought that is a female playing this game then please get in touch. i am ideally looking for a smaller corp that i can be an active part of as opposed to some huge faceless corp.
Im sure that there is the right corp out there for me somewhere! i just want to play and have fun !!!

Originally by: Andian You mentioned that you grew bored due to lack of content and then you mention that all you wish to do is PvP.
Well ok. It just seems that you give yourself very little room to manoeuvre.

Whats the connection here ? i dont see it.
In the first few months of the game it was a race to get the biggest ship. once you had a cruiser, frigates where redundant - battleships made cruisers redundant etc. Now things seem to have balanced out more so that frigates still have a purpose in fleet battles, especiallt now with things like inty's, af's, stealth etc. This is why i have returned to the game, there is more content for doing PVP.
